Sesame Peanut Noodles Recipe

Ingredients:

For the noodles
8 ounces whole-wheat spaghetti

For the dressing
1/4 cup peanut sauce
1 tablespoon dark sesame oil
1/2 lime squeezed
1/2 cup hot water

For assembling
1/2 bag store-bought coleslaw mix
1/2 cup red pepper
1/2 cup cilantro, chopped
1/2 lime, squeezed
1/2 cup diced apple
1 teaspoon toasted sesame seeds
2 scallions, julienne

Directions:

Bring a pot of water to a boil for the pasta, and cook the pasta according to package instructions. Drain and return to the pan.

While the pasta is cooking combine the dressing ingredients and stir it into the pasta right after it's drained and toss. Set aside to cool.

Stir in the coleslaw mix, red pepper and cilantro. Squeeze a half of a lime over the mixture, and toss.

Add the remaining ingredients, toss and refrigerate for one hour to chill through. Garnish with chopped peanuts, cilantro and lime wedges. Serve.

Personal Notes:

The peanut flavor is a wonderful background flavor and the taste of the veggies, especially the cilantro come thru as the main flavor.
